		<title>Trademark Infringement 101 - How to determine who is bidding on trademarks</title>
		<description>Important: When reporting infringement to networks, search engines, hosting services, etc., be sure to provide as much evidence as possible.  Screen shots of the ad, as you saw it displayed on the search engines, of Landing Pages, of Clickstream Investigation results, etc.

When it comes to protecting and defending your trademarks, ...</description>
